H-1B sponsored Athletic Trainers roles in South Carolina command an average salary of $62k, ranging from $50k to $68k. The top sponsors include Spartanburg School District 7 (75%), COASTAL CAROLINA UNIVERSITY (25%). 75% of petitions are certified. Based on 4 H-1B filings in this state.

Prevailing Wage Analysis

100% of filings offer salaries above the prevailing wage, with an average premium of 12.1%. The average prevailing wage is $56k (based on 4 filings with prevailing wage data).

Processing Time

Average processing time is 6 days (median: 7 days). Fastest: 3 days, slowest: 7 days. Based on 4 filings.

Workforce Insights

25% of filings are for new positions, while 50% are for continued employment (4 filings with data).

Average contract duration: 30 months (median: 36 months), based on 4 filings.
